Abdel Fattah Sisi met with the Israeli Prime Minister

Egyptian President Abdel Fattah Sisi met with Israeli Prime Minister Naftali Bennett in the resort city of Sharm el-Sheikh.

Axar.az reports that the sides exchanged views on the Israeli-Palestinian peace process, regional and international issues.

It should be noted that the Egyptian mediation mission between Israel and Hamas played an important role in achieving a ceasefire.

Egyptian President's Spokesman Bassam Radi said that the parties agreed to continue fruitful consultations at various levels.
